Summary
The Land Clearance for Redevelopment Authority of the City of Saint Louis (“LCRA” or “Authority”) is seeking bids for Selective Demolition Services at 3451 Bingham Avenue and 4352 Louisiana, which are ancillary buildings connected to the former Cleveland High School. LCRA is seeking services from a qualified firm St. Louis city certified eligible demolition contractor to perform comprehensive environmental remediation, hazardous materials abatement, and demolition work on four sections of the building. Utilities are not operational or available onsite.

LCRA acquired the historic Cleveland High School with the intention of preserving the original school building and stabilizing it for future redevelopment. These ancillary buildings do not contribute to the historic value of the building and cannot easily be incorporated into a future use without expending unreasonable and infeasible funds. The redevelopment is expected to be residential with an affordable housing component.

The services to be provided through this RFB will be funded by The Coronavirus State and Local Fiscal Recovery Fund allocated to the City of St. Louis by the United States Department of the Treasury and passed through the City’s Community Development Administration to SLDC.
